Desert Knowledge Australia-Outback Business Networks (OBN) event Friday 24 February 2012

Desert Knowledge Australia is a national organisation that identifies key projects that contribute to a social, economic and environmentally sustainable future for desert Australia.

Reproduced from Desert Knowledge Australia
Outback Business Networks website


On Friday 24th February 2012 Desert Knowledge Australia is holding a 'Cross Border Meeting' - "Bringing Back Business: Creative Solutions for Developing Districts".


Four presenters, including Broken Hill's Bell's Milk Bar & Museum owner Jason King, will discuss projects that are making a difference in communities and rejuvenating business and retail districts in towns and cities across Australia.  I am all for this sort of initiative.  It's part of why I started my www.ilovebrokenhill.com site.
